Cool thing about evos is you can replace them with any aftermarket evo style motor, S&S, ultima... I'd say get a 100" plus ultima motor for cheap and throw it in there if you need a new motor. Or hell get an el bruto 127 in there and you d be set

That right there seems to be the issue. The "old" mechanics were not familiar with FI when it came out. Many weren't to enthusiastic about learning.
To the young guys EVOs are old motors. They are familiar with the Twinkies.
Find a reputable indy in your area.
Sounds like the bike is in great shape, what is wrong with the engine?
